Seven of the 33 banks with more than $100 billion in assets are above the threshold. The Bank of New York Mellon has a 100% ratio of uninsured deposits, followed by State Street Bank, 92.6%; Northern Trust, 73.9%; Citibank, 72.5%; HSBC Bank, 69.8%; J.P Morgan Chase, 51.7% and U.S. Bank, 50.4%.
Ans. The National Asset Reconstruction Company Limited (NARCL) is commonly referred to as India's Bad Bank. Ans. A Bad Bank is a financial entity that buys and manages stressed assets or Non-Performing Assets (NPAs) from commercial banks to help clean their balance sheets.

KfW in 2022 again remains the "world's safest bank". For the fourteenth time in a row, the US finance magazine Global Finance declared KfW the “World's Safest Bank”.
